Address

3CiC5oqhgoq86e4msW2mWvsxofgCLZzGge
Confirmed tx count
37
Confirmed received
25 outputs (0.03019074 BTC)
Confirmed spent
13 outputs (0.01680266 BTC)
Confirmed unspent
12 outputs (0.01338808 BTC)

25-37 of 37 Transactions